diff options
author | Leon Scroggins <scroggo@google.com> | 2010-04-27 12:27:19 -0700 |
---|---|---|
committer | Android Git Automerger <android-git-automerger@android.com> | 2010-04-27 12:27:19 -0700 |
commit | 07229e0817eb8a9e507b0a7b0ba3fc8dff839359 (patch) | |
tree | ef5893116231f38274f43c35d87967ccf0346640 | |
parent | 3a04dd3fa9c62d940256057ac36bf5f1f9281eb3 (diff) | |
parent | faea5646b25a94c669c5c63474d6c1c943599bea (diff) | |
download | packages_apps_Browser-07229e0817eb8a9e507b0a7b0ba3fc8dff839359.zip packages_apps_Browser-07229e0817eb8a9e507b0a7b0ba3fc8dff839359.tar.gz packages_apps_Browser-07229e0817eb8a9e507b0a7b0ba3fc8dff839359.tar.bz2 |
am faea5646: Do not try to open a file that could not be downloaded.
-rw-r--r-- | src/com/android/browser/OpenDownloadReceiver.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/com/android/browser/OpenDownloadReceiver.java b/src/com/android/browser/OpenDownloadReceiver.java index da53fb2..814aa9c 100644 --- a/src/com/android/browser/OpenDownloadReceiver.java +++ b/src/com/android/browser/OpenDownloadReceiver.java @@ -50,7 +50,8 @@ public class OpenDownloadReceiver extends BroadcastReceiver { String action = intent.getAction(); if (Downloads.ACTION_NOTIFICATION_CLICKED.equals(action)) { int status = cursor.getInt(3); - if (Downloads.isStatusCompleted(status)) { + if (Downloads.isStatusCompleted(status) + && Downloads.isStatusSuccess(status)) { Intent launchIntent = new Intent(Intent.ACTION_VIEW); Uri path = Uri.parse(filename); // If there is no scheme, then it must be a file |